Kinds of Leather

Understanding the type of leather is vital when selecting a sofa. Each type provides distinct qualities, and your choice will influence convenience, price, and upkeep. Here are the most typical types of leather utilized in sofas:

Type of LeatherDescriptionProsCons
Full-Grain LeatherThe highest quality, keeps the natural grain and flawsDurable, develops a patinaPricey
Top-Grain LeatherThe second greatest quality, sanded and dealt with to remove flawsMore inexpensive than full-grainMay use quicker than full-grain
Split LeatherMade from the lower layers of the conceal, often bonded for costCost-efficientLess durable
Bonded LeatherMade from leather scraps combined with artificial materialsExtremely budget friendlyLess durable

Care and Maintenance

Correct care can substantially extend the lifespan of a leather sofa. Here's an easy upkeep guide: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Use a soft, dry fabric to clean down the sofa weekly. For deeper cleaning, use a moist fabric with leather cleaner every couple of months.
  2. Conditioning: Apply a leather conditioner every 6-12 months to keep the leather supple.
  3. Prevent Direct Sunlight: Prolonged exposure can fade the color and damage the leather.
  4. Prompt Stain Removal: Address spills instantly with a soft fabric. For hard discolorations, consult a professional leather cleaner.
  5. Avoid Sharp Objects: Keep animals' claws cut and prevent sharp things around the sofa to prevent scratches.
